How they compare

Cambodia currently reports 5.7% against 5.5% in Haiti, a difference of 0.2%.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 26 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Haiti ahead.

Cambodia ranks 181st and Haiti ranks 182nd of 187 countries.

Haiti has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Cambodia Haiti Difference Ahead
2000s 5.5% 7.4% 1.8% Haiti
2010s 5.6% 7.6% 2.0% Haiti
2020s 5.9% 6.6% 0.7% Haiti

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Final consumption expenditure is expenditure on goods and services by resident institutional units for the direct satisfaction of human needs or wants, whether individual or collective. General government FCE includes all government current expenditures for purchases of goods and services (including compensation of employees), and most expenditures on national defense and security, but excludes government military expenditures that are part of government capital formation. This indicator is expressed as a percentage of Gross Domestic Product (GDP) which is the total income earned through the production of goods and services in an economic territory during an accounting period.
